UGC-NET/JRF EXAMINATION, June 2010 SOCIOLOGY Paper – II

Note : This paper contains fifty (50) objective type questions, each question having answer in bold.

1. Who among the following authors initially used the term ‘social physics’ for Sociology?
(B) Comte

2. An author thought of ‘society to be consisting in the consciousness of kind’.
Identify from among the following:
(D) Giddings

3. What does the social relationship primarily involve ?
(C) Consciousness of other people

4. A group organized to achieve a certain purpose is known as which among the following ?
(C) Association

5. Who among the following thought of religion to an opium of the people ?
(C) Marx

6. Who said : “Civilisation is always advancing but not culture.” ?
(B) MacIver

9.Ceremonies that mark a critical transition in the life of an individual from one phase of life-cycle to another are called
(B) Rites of Passage

10. Who among the following gave the concept of anticipatory socialisation?
(A) Merton

13. When a girl of the higher caste marries a boy of the lower caste, the
system is known as
(D) Pratiloma

(C) People are able to modify or alter the symbols used in Interaction based on the interpretation of situation.

36. According to Marx, which of the following is considered to be the most crucial element for class struggle?
(B) Class consciousness

37. Who was the first to use the comparative method or indirect experiment method in Sociology?
(B) Emile Durkheim

38. Who has used ‘participant observation’ method for collection of data ?
(B) B. Malinowski

39. Who has written on ‘objectivity’ in his methodological writings?
(B) Emile Durkheim

41. Who has propounded the idea that we can treat social facts
(phenomena) as things ?
(C) Emile Durkheim

42. Which type of question(s) are investigated in exploratory research design ?
(D) All the above

43. Which method is more suitable for collecting data from non-literate communities ?
(B) Observation

44. Purpose of case study method is
(C) To explore maximum possible relationships of a phenomenon.

50. In which one of the following concepts has M.N. Srinivas explained caste mobility as a process of Social and Cultural change?
(A) Sanskritization
